				It definitely should on paper.  The problem becomes that with what little we have to go on here (no bloodwork to know how he’s bouncing back), it’s hard to advise.  For all we know, he started with a natural test level on the high end and he’s now on the lower end.  If that’s the case, even a short ester 8 week run could result in him being hypo, in which case he’ll be far worse off than now, within a few months.
One of the nastier myths that still goes around is that “proper PCT” works all of the time.  There are some people that it just flat out doesn’t ever work for, and they end up being TRT candidates for life.
